Thompson graduates from Georgia South-western State University

Posted

Payton Thompson of Garfield graduated from Georgia Southwestern State University during the Fall 2024 Commencement Ceremony held on Thursday, Dec. 12 in the Convocation Hall of the Student Success Center. Thompson earned a Bachelor of Science in Criminal Justice.

588 students graduated in the ceremony, during which Georgia State Representative Patty Marie Stinson delivered the commencement address.
